Abstract

Documentation of digital artwork is essential for designers, serving as a copyrightable asset that can be included in a student's portfolio. User interface design is chosen as the gateway for developing the PDBI Digital Art Gallery Application. It is anticipated that a well-designed user interface will be part of the feasibility analysis for further development into a comprehensive and beneficial application. The research method employed in this study is design thinking, involving the construction of a user interface and usability testing for the PDBI digital art gallery application using a qualitative approach with a case study research type. Data collection techniques include observation, competitor analysis, and questionnaire distribution to obtain user experience feedback on the application. The introduction of the PDBI Digital Art Gallery application is expected to enable PDBI students to easily archive, showcase, sell, and create digital works, empowering student digital products as intended.

Abstract

A company profile is a detailed representation of a company, aimed at attracting customer attention and interest. Among the various forms of company profiles, video is one of the most effective. The Multimedia Engineering Technology Study Program at Boash Indonesia Digital Polytechnic (PDBI) currently lacks a profile video, which could serve as a significant promotional tool. This research aims to develop an informative and promotional medium in the form of a motion graphic-based profile video. The method employed is the Multimedia Development Life Cycle (MDLC). The resulting motion graphic-based profile video is designed to support promotional activities, presented in an educational and communicative manner to ensure effective delivery to the audience.
